How can a society built entirely around the principle of inequality become democratic? India has implemented a policy of affirmative action for the members of the lower or "untouchable" caste, who represent more than half of the population: those who meet the policy's requirements will be employed as civil servants. THE CASTE STRUGGLE documents the results of this controversial policy, a legislative attempt to bring social and political change to India.
